Enthalpy:
Sol: The enthalpy is total energy of gaseous system. It takes into consideration, internal energy and pressure, volume effect. Thus, it can be defined as follows:
h = u + Pv
H = U + PV
Where v is specific volume and V is the whole volume of m Kg gas. h is specific enthalpy where as H is total enthalpy of m kg gas u is specific internal energy while U is total internal energy of m kg gas. From ideal gas equation,
Pv = RT
h = u + RT
h = f (T) + RT Thus, h is also function of temperature for perfect gas.
Therefore, h is also function of temperature for the perfect gas.
